Output e143271ff1f9a788af74ca459a577f60facd48e9e23d138048224443fce99303:1

value
376471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d907dd8e32b22f3fabb42535bb296930c199c51 OP_EQUAL
address
38m93mQVWbJfUGHJkxMghHs7ePphQL5q4d
transaction
e143271ff1f9a788af74ca459a577f60facd48e9e23d138048224443fce99303
confirmations
293072
spent
true